                            FENTANYL CRISIS

  (Mr. HARRIS asked and was given permission to address the House for 1 
minute and to revise and extend his remarks.)
  Mr. HARRIS. Mr. Speaker, we surpassed 100,000 overdose deaths this 
year, a 28 percent increase. The amount of fentanyl seized at our 
southern border--seized--is over 100 million pills and 11,000 pounds. 
Now, as a physician who has administered fentanyl, this is enough to 
kill hundreds of millions of Americans. The price of heroin is now down 
to $20 a dose; the price of fentanyl down to $2.
  One stunning supply chain success this administration has under its 
belt is the fentanyl supply chain across our southern border. One place 
this administration has successfully fought inflation is in lowering 
the price of illegal opioids on our streets.
  The latest effort by this administration to promote drug use is now 
to spend $30 million to supply clean crack-smoking pipes to addicts.
  Mr. Speaker, just say no.
